How Do Accents and Dialects Develop?

Jul 21, 2021

Accents and dialects develop during early childhood, until approximately 7-8 years of age, and they come from your peers, friends, and social groups, not your parents.  It’s true!  

Many children are born in or move to a region that is different from where their parents were born and these children always sound like their friends and neighbors, not their parents.
